  • Patent number: 4930941
    Abstract: A customer terminal for a single tube pneumatic system for banking and the like features a two-piece carrier receiver which includes a carrier tray that first moves downwardly from a stationary receiver housing and then forwardly and upwardly to present a carrier in the tray to a customer, the tray and carrier remaining parallel to the receiver housing. The tray is resiliently mounted to the mechanism which manipulates it and the joint between the tray and housing is contoured both to improve sealing between the two parts and to reduce wear on the seal itself. The air pressure/exhaust ports into the carrier chamber within the receiver are disposed between the ends of the chamber in order to provide an air cushion for reducing the shock of an arriving carrier and to prevent loose items in the system from being sucked into the blower.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: November 21, 1988
    Date of Patent: June 5, 1990
    Assignee: Inter Innovation LeFebure Mfg. Corp.
    Inventors: Clair L. Willey, David H. Ayer
  • Patent number: 4135684
    Abstract: The customer station or terminal of a pneumatic carrier system for drive-up banking and the like employing a single interconnecting tube features a horizontally disposed, tubular carrier receiver connected at one end to the tube and slotted adjacent its other end for insertion and removal of a carrier. The slotted aperture is opened and closed by a sliding sleeve controlled by the arrival of a carrier at and its subsequent replacement in the receiver by a customer.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: August 17, 1977
    Date of Patent: January 23, 1979
    Assignee: Walter Kidde & Company, Inc.
    Inventor: Clair L. Willey
